april 28, 2011
ASSISTIVE tECHNOLOGY eXPO & TRAINING
The Communication Technology Education Center is hosting an exposition and training in conjunction with the Supported Life Institute and InAlliance. The event is scheduled for Thursday, April 28, 2011 from 9:00am until 4:00pm at the Red Lion Hotel at Arden Village in Sacramento.
CTEC provides services in Augmentative & Alternative Communication (AAC) to deliver personalized methods or devices to increase a person’s ability to communicate. The Expo & Training is an excellent opportunity to learn what devices are available, try low-tech, mid-tech and high-tech devices, and learn how to use devices. Consumers, family member and professionals are all encouraged to attend.

March 19, 2011
ACCESS TO CARE FAIR, rOSEVILLE, ca
InAlliance will be exhibiting at the A Touch of Understanding 6th Annual “Access to Care Fair” on Saturday, March 19th at the Bayside Church in Roseville, CA, located at 8191 Sierra College Boulevard. The event is designed to offer practical and professional resources to families and individuals who have developmental disabilities and special needs. The fair runs Saturday from 9:00am until 1:00pm and is free and open the public.
